#c69419 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c69419 is composed of 77.6% red, 58% green and 9.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 25.3% magenta, 87.4% yellow and 22.4% black. It has a hue angle of 42.7 degrees, a saturation of 77.6% and a lightness of 43.7%. #c69419 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ff32 with #8d2900. Closest websafe color is: #cc9900.

#c69419 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#c69419 has RGB values of R:198, G:148, B:25 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.25, Y:0.87,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 13014041.

Hex triplet c69419 #c69419
RGB Decimal 198, 148, 25 rgb(198,148,25)
RGB Percent 77.6, 58, 9.8 rgb(77.6%,58%,9.8%)
CMYK 0, 25, 87, 22
HSL 42.7°, 77.6, 43.7 hsl(42.7,77.6%,43.7%)
HSV (or HSB) 42.7°, 87.4, 77.6
Web Safe cc9900 #cc9900
CIE-LAB 64.369, 8.708, 64.433
XYZ 34.055, 33.258, 5.545
xyY 0.467, 0.456, 33.258
CIE-LCH 64.369, 65.018, 82.303
CIE-LUV 64.369, 41.866, 63.864
Hunter-Lab 57.669, 4.486, 34.667
Binary 11000110, 10010100, 00011001

Shades and Tints of #c69419

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060501 is the darkest color, while #fefbf4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#c69419

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#70706f is the less saturated color, while #d79b08 is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#c69419 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#959595 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#9f957c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#b4a127 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#c99925 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#d08f99 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#ba9c22 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#c89720 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#cc916a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
